In addition, an American living and dealing outside the united states (expat) may exclude from taxable income the income earned from work outside the states. This exclusion is in two parts. Fundamental exclusion is proscribed to USD 95,100 for the 2012 tax year, and in addition USD 97,600 for the 2013 tax year. These amounts are determined on a daily pro rata cause all days on that this expat qualifies for the exclusion. In addition, the expat may exclude the number of he or she carried housing in the foreign country in an excessive amount 16% among the basic difference. This housing exclusion is restricted by jurisdiction. For 2012, the housing exclusion may be the amount paid in way over USD 41.57 per day. For 2013, the amounts of more than USD 42.78 per day may be omitted.

For example, if you've made under $100,000 annually, approximately $25,000 of rental income losses become qualified as deductible, and you can save thousands of dollars on other income origins through this reduction in price. However, if you earn over $100,000 a year, this deduction begins to phase out, until usually completely gone for taxpayers earning $150,000 and above annually.
